Locations of Ancient Fords on the Sula River

Abstract: It is known that from ancient times rivers were not only a source of water and certain types of food, but also significant obstacles for overland travel. This especially applies toto the second-order watercourses, the length of which reached hundreds of kilometers, making it simply impossible to bypass them, including the right tributary of the Dnipro River — the Sula.
